Monitoring Engineer
Alpharetta, GA Contract US Citizen, GC Holder, EAD and TN
Job Responsibilities:- Responsible for analyzing existing monitoring solutions, understanding the roles of the applications they cover, and configuring, developing, and enhancing those solutions during the Datacenter Migration.
- Under limited direction, expand and enhance monitoring, alerting, and reporting on our newly migrated platforms
- Participate in requirements gathering & scope discussions for applications or platforms being migrated that do not already have effective monitoring coverage
- Assist in the development, deployment, and refinement of monitoring standards
- 3-5 years of experience required (5+ Preferred)
- Work experience should indicate previous experience in at least 2 of the following areas:
- Tomcat Web development
- Java programming
- JavaScript programming
- Perl scripting
- Log Monitoring
- Infrastructure Monitoring
- Application & Performance Monitoring
- Network Monitoring
- Some experience with Databases (Oracle, SQL Server)
- Previous experience developing, deploying, and refining Dashboards, Alerts, & Reports
- A strong knowledge of the relationship between software and hardware interaction
- Strong writing & documentation skills
- Familiarity with Microsoft® Word & Excel
